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: disable button on create whatsapp channel #331

Merged
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@
"dependencies": {
"@sentry/integrations": "^6.13.2",
"@sentry/vue": "^6.13.2",
"@weni/unnnic-system": "^1.16.41",
"@weni/unnnic-system": "^1.16.51",
"axios": "0.21.1",
"core-js": "^3.6.5",
"global": "^4.4.0",
Expand Down
4 changes: 2 additions & 2 deletions src/components/config/channels/whatsapp/Setup.vue
Original file line number Diff line number Diff line change
Expand Up @@ -71,13 +71,13 @@
:text="$t('WhatsAppCloud.config.phone_numbers.connect_later')"
@click="closePopUp"
></unnnic-button>

<!-- eslint-disable -->
<LoadingButton
class="phone-number-selection__buttons__save"
type="terciary"
size="large"
:disabled="
loadingPhoneNumbers || loadingDebugToken || !!errorDebugToken || !!errorPhoneNumbers
loadingPhoneNumbers || loadingDebugToken || !!errorDebugToken || !!errorPhoneNumbers || loadingWhatsAppCloudConfigure
"
:isLoading="loadingWhatsAppCloudConfigure"
:loadingText="$t('general.loading')"
Expand Down
120 changes: 60 additions & 60 deletions tests/unit/specs/components/__snapshots__/OnboardModal.spec.js.snap

Large diffs are not rendered by default.

8 changes: 4 additions & 4 deletions tests/unit/specs/components/__snapshots__/Survey.spec.js.snap
Original file line number Diff line number Diff line change
Expand Up @@ -21,15 +21,15 @@ exports[`components/Survey.vue should be rendered properly with content open 1`]
</div>
<!---->
</div>
<div class="survey__content__buttons"><button data-v-c21b2f22="" class="survey__content__buttons__exit unnnic-button unnnic-button--size-small unnnic-button--terciary unnnic-button-scheme--">
<div class="survey__content__buttons"><button data-v-bcdcecac="" class="survey__content__buttons__exit unnnic-button unnnic-button--size-small unnnic-button--terciary unnnic-button-scheme--">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Exit </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Exit </span>
<!---->
</button> <button data-v-c21b2f22="" class="survey__content__buttons__send unnnic-button unnnic-button--size-small unnnic-button--secondary unnnic-button-scheme--">
</button> <button data-v-bcdcecac="" class="survey__content__buttons__send unnnic-button unnnic-button--size-small unnnic-button--secondary unnnic-button-scheme--">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Send </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Send </span>
<!---->
</button></div>
</div>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-12,15 +12,15 @@ exports[`components/config/channels/generic/Config.vue should be rendered proper
<div class="app-config-generic__settings__content">
<div class="app-config-generic__settings__content__form-loading"><span class="unnnic-skeleton" style="background-color: rgb(232, 244, 244); animation: SkeletonLoading 1.5s ease-in-out infinite; width: 100%; height: 100%;">‌</span></div>
</div>
<div class="app-config-generic__settings__buttons"><button data-v-c21b2f22="" class="app-config-generic__settings__buttons__cancel unnnic-button unnnic-button--size-large unnnic-button--terciary unnnic-button-scheme--">
<div class="app-config-generic__settings__buttons"><button data-v-bcdcecac="" class="app-config-generic__settings__buttons__cancel unnnic-button unnnic-button--size-large unnnic-button--terciary unnnic-button-scheme--">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Cancel </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Cancel </span>
<!---->
</button> <button data-v-c21b2f22="" class="app-config-generic__settings__buttons__save unnnic-button unnnic-button--size-large unnnic-button--secondary unnnic-button-scheme--">
</button> <button data-v-bcdcecac="" class="app-config-generic__settings__buttons__save unnnic-button unnnic-button--size-large unnnic-button--secondary unnnic-button-scheme--">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Save changes </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Save changes </span>
<!---->
</button></div>
</div>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-66,15 +66,15 @@ exports[`components/config/channels/whatsapp/components/tabs/WebhookTab.vue shou
</div>
</div>
</div>
<div class="webhook-info__buttons"><button data-v-c21b2f22="" class="webhook-info__buttons__cancel unnnic-button unnnic-button--size-large unnnic-button--terciary unnnic-button-scheme--">
<div class="webhook-info__buttons"><button data-v-bcdcecac="" class="webhook-info__buttons__cancel unnnic-button unnnic-button--size-large unnnic-button--terciary unnnic-button-scheme--">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Configure later </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Configure later </span>
<!---->
</button> <button data-v-c21b2f22="" class="webhook-info__buttons__save unnnic-button unnnic-button--size-large unnnic-button--secondary unnnic-button-scheme--">
</button> <button data-v-bcdcecac="" class="webhook-info__buttons__save unnnic-button unnnic-button--size-large unnnic-button--secondary unnnic-button-scheme--">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Save changes </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Save changes </span>
<!---->
</button></div>
</div>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-47,15 +47,15 @@ exports[`components/config/external/omie/Config.vue should be rendered properly
<div data-v-69271fcc=""></div>
</div>
</div>
<div data-v-69271fcc="" class="app-config-omie__settings__buttons"><button data-v-c21b2f22="" class="app-config-omie__settings__buttons__cancel unnnic-button unnnic-button--size-large unnnic-button--terciary unnnic-button-scheme--" data-v-69271fcc="">
<div data-v-69271fcc="" class="app-config-omie__settings__buttons"><button data-v-bcdcecac="" class="app-config-omie__settings__buttons__cancel unnnic-button unnnic-button--size-large unnnic-button--terciary unnnic-button-scheme--" data-v-69271fcc="">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Cancel </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Cancel </span>
<!---->
</button> <button data-v-c21b2f22="" class="app-config-omie__settings__buttons__save unnnic-button unnnic-button--size-large unnnic-button--secondary unnnic-button-scheme--" data-v-69271fcc="">
</button> <button data-v-bcdcecac="" class="app-config-omie__settings__buttons__save unnnic-button unnnic-button--size-large unnnic-button--secondary unnnic-button-scheme--" data-v-69271fcc="">
<!---->
<!---->
<!----><span data-v-c21b2f22="" class="unnnic-button__label"> Connect </span>
<!----><span data-v-bcdcecac="" class="unnnic-button__label"> Connect </span>
<!---->
</button></div>
</div>
Expand Down
Loading
Loading